Transaction 57b70bfbd8102ffeb4d190895e5e14f3bfcbbf3e473ead1a1d70d64b84676686

1 Input
1 Outputs
  • 57b70bfbd8102ffeb4d190895e5e14f3bfcbbf3e473ead1a1d70d64b84676686:0
  • value  4950000
    address  1Ep5ZtTrcYsLoDttVntrEzUDcogReYERZ8